The Impact of Gender-Based Violence on Access to Safe Abortion Services

Gender-based violence, including physical, sexual, or emotional abuse, often results in unplanned pregnancies. Survivors of gender-based violence may face barriers in accessing safe abortion services due to legal restrictions, stigma, or lack of supportive healthcare systems.

Legal and Policy Considerations

In many regions, restrictive laws and policies regarding abortion further exacerbate the challenges faced by survivors of gender-based violence. Additionally, the criminalization of abortion may force individuals to seek unsafe and clandestine procedures, risking their health and well-being.

Healthcare Access and Support

Survivors of gender-based violence require comprehensive healthcare services, including access to safe abortion care. Ensuring trauma-informed care and support for survivors is critical in addressing the intersection of gender-based violence and abortion. Healthcare providers play a pivotal role in offering compassionate and nonjudgmental care.

Intersectional Perspectives

The intersection of gender-based violence and access to safe abortion services is further complicated by intersecting forms of oppression, including racism, poverty, and discrimination. Understanding these intersecting factors is essential in developing inclusive and effective support systems.

Challenging Stigma and Misconceptions

Stigma surrounding both gender-based violence and abortion perpetuates harmful myths and misconceptions. Addressing societal stigmas and providing education can empower survivors and communities to seek the support they need without fear of judgment or discrimination.
